xfgryujk / blivechat

用于OBS的仿YouTube风格的bilibili直播评论栏
https://blive.chat
MIT License
2.23k stars 255 forks source link

Relay 方式传递 author_id (uid) #138

Closed reitowo closed 1 year ago

xfgryujk commented 1 year ago

你自己改得了……我这没必要给前端传UID

reitowo commented 1 year ago

需求是可以复用你的/api/chat连接去做其他比如点歌板的应用

xfgryujk commented 1 year ago

需求是可以复用你的/api/chat连接去做其他比如点歌板的应用

这也不需要UID啊,我等下做个demo

reitowo commented 1 year ago

需求是可以复用你的/api/chat连接去做其他比如点歌板的应用

这也不需要UID啊,我等下做个demo

有什么区别呢,那你拿username做cd功能吗,如果我点个歌改个名怎么办,另外加一个uid能影响啥? 担心远程部署的流量吗?

xfgryujk commented 1 year ago

我为啥要为了你的需求改自己的协议,我还以为你是给用户本地用呢,你是想通过chat.bilisc.com转发?

reitowo commented 1 year ago

本地转发啊,啥叫为了我的需求呢,blivechat用户广泛,如果其他基于blivechat的工具可以直接在本地复用blivechat的连接,这不是一件好事吗,而且blivechat本身大部分都是在本地用的吧

如果什么需求都自己做一个fork不是徒增麻烦吗,加一个uid这个都不能讨论不能商议,你开源的意义何在呢

reitowo commented 1 year ago

就拿本地跑个点歌板举例,既然大家都在用你blivechat,那新开发一个这种应用,如果可以直接复用你的连接,并通过relay方式,把你这个私有协议加一种这种用法,以此获取数据,不是造福大家吗,而且合入上流也不用让用户去下各种各样魔改的blivechat版本

reitowo commented 1 year ago

已修改,感谢理解